The honest brief
Kling AI
Kuaishou's video model leads on motion realism and multishot sequences — the strongest non-Western Sora/Runway rival.
- Convincing complex motion and physics
- Lip-sync on generated clips
- Fast, high-volume social output
- Image generation included
- Credit-based pricing adds up
- Clip length limited (~15s)
- Closed source, hosted only
PixVerse
Tuned for stylized, anime, and VFX-transition output at high speed, where Veo and Sora optimize for photorealism.
- Fast generation
- Text-to-video and image-to-video
- Web, mobile, and developer API
- Effects and transition templates
- Less photoreal than frontier rivals
- Short clip durations
- Single proprietary model, no choice
